What Is A Neonatal Patient Monitor?
A Neonatal Patient Monitor is a sophisticated medical device specifically engineered to continuously track and display vital physiological parameters in newborns and premature infants. These delicate patients often have immature organ systems and require precise, real-time monitoring to ensure their stability and detect any emergent clinical issues swiftly. The monitor acts as a crucial extension of the clinical team, providing essential data that informs diagnosis, treatment adjustments, and overall care management within the neonatal intensive care unit (NICU) or other critical care settings.
Its primary function is to gather, process, and present a comprehensive overview of a neonate's condition. This involves measuring parameters like heart rate, respiration rate, blood oxygen saturation (SpO2), non-invasive blood pressure, and sometimes even temperature and end-tidal CO2. By trending this data over time, clinicians can identify subtle changes that might otherwise go unnoticed, allowing for proactive intervention before a situation becomes critical.

How Much Is A Neonatal Patient Monitor In Ivory Coast?
Understanding the investment required for a neonatal patient monitor in Ivory Coast involves considering a range of factors, from the sophistication of the device to the supplier and any additional services. For basic, reliable models, healthcare facilities can expect to allocate a budget in the range of 1,500,000 FCFA to 3,000,000 FCFA. These units typically offer essential monitoring capabilities such as heart rate, respiration, and oxygen saturation.
For more advanced systems, incorporating features like non-invasive blood pressure monitoring, temperature regulation, and integrated data logging and connectivity, prices can escalate. These higher-end neonatal patient monitors generally fall within the range of 3,500,000 FCFA to 7,000,000 FCFA or more. The final cost can also be influenced by the reputation of the manufacturer, the warranty provided, and whether installation and training are included in the package. It is advisable for procurement departments to obtain detailed quotes from multiple reputable medical equipment suppliers operating within Ivory Coast to ensure competitive pricing and the best value for their specific needs.
- Basic Neonatal Patient Monitors: 1,500,000 FCFA - 3,000,000 FCFA
- Advanced Neonatal Patient Monitors: 3,500,000 FCFA - 7,000,000+ FCFA
